
MySQL,作为一款开源的关系型数据库管理系统(RDBMS),凭借其出色的性能、灵活的可扩展性以及广泛的应用支持,在众多数据库解决方案中脱颖而出,成为无数企业和开发者信赖的选择
本文将通过“duocijo”(一个虚构的数据分析与处理专家角色)的视角,深入探讨MySQL在数据管理、性能优化、安全防护以及数据分析方面的卓越表现,揭示其如何助力企业在数据洪流中乘风破浪
一、MySQL:数据管理的基石 duocijo是一位对数据充满热情的专业人士,他深知在海量数据面前,一个稳定、高效的数据存储与处理平台至关重要
MySQL正是他心中理想的数据库解决方案
从最基本的创建表、插入数据到复杂的查询优化、事务处理,MySQL提供了一套完整且易于上手的工具集
-灵活的数据模型:MySQL支持多种数据类型,包括整数、浮点数、字符串、日期时间等,能够满足不同业务场景的需求
更重要的是,它支持外键约束、索引机制等,确保了数据的完整性和查询效率
-事务处理:对于需要高度数据一致性的应用场景,MySQL提供了ACID(原子性、一致性、隔离性、持久性)事务支持,确保即使在系统崩溃的情况下,数据也能恢复到一致状态
-复制与集群:为了应对数据增长带来的挑战,MySQL提供了主从复制、读写分离等功能,有效分散了读写压力,提升了系统整体性能
此外,通过构建MySQL集群,可以进一步实现高可用性和负载均衡,确保业务连续性
二、性能优化:让数据跑得更快 duocijo深知,一个高效的数据库不仅仅是存储数据的容器,更是加速数据流转、提升业务响应速度的关键
MySQL在性能优化方面提供了丰富的策略和工具,帮助他不断挖掘系统的潜能
-查询优化:MySQL的查询优化器能够自动分析执行计划,选择最优的查询路径
同时,通过合理使用索引(如B树索引、哈希索引)、优化SQL语句(避免SELECT、使用JOIN代替子查询等),可以显著提升查询性能
-缓存机制:MySQL内置了查询缓存和InnoDB缓冲池,能够有效减少磁盘I/O操作,加快数据访问速度
合理配置这些缓存参数,对于提升系统性能至关重要
-分区与分表:面对大规模数据集,通过水平或垂直分区将数据分散到不同的物理存储单元,或是采用分表策略,可以显著减少单个表的负担,提高数据访问效率
三、安全防护:守护数据安全的坚固防线 在数据泄露风险日益加剧的今天,duocijo对数据安全有着极高的敏感性
MySQL在安全防护方面同样表现出色,为他提供了多层次的安全保障
-用户权限管理:MySQL支持细粒度的访问控制,可以为不同用户分配不同的数据库、表、视图等操作权限,确保只有授权用户才能访问敏感数据
-加密与审计:通过启用SSL/TLS加密,MySQL可以在数据传输过程中保护数据不被窃取或篡改
同时,启用审计日志功能,可以记录所有数据库操作,便于追踪和调查安全事件
-备份与恢复:定期备份数据库是防范数据丢失的有效手段
MySQL提供了多种备份方式,如逻辑备份(mysqldump)、物理备份(Percona XtraBackup)等,结合合理的恢复策略,能够在灾难发生时迅速恢复数据
四、数据分析:挖掘数据背后的价值 作为数据分析与处理专家,duocijo深知数据的价值在于其背后的洞察
MySQL不仅是一个强大的数据存储平台,还能够与多种数据分析工具无缝集成,助力他挖掘数据的深层价值
-集成大数据生态:MySQL能够与Hadoop、Spark等大数据处理框架结合,实现大规模数据的离线分析和实时处理
通过导出数据到这些平台,duocijo能够运行复杂的分析任务,发现数据中的隐藏模式
-报表与可视化:MySQL支持多种数据导出格式(如CSV、JSON),便于与Tableau、Power BI等报表和可视化工具对接
通过这些工具,duocijo能够轻松创建直观的图表和仪表板,将复杂数据转化为易于理解的视觉信息,为决策提供有力支持
-存储过程与触发器:MySQL允许定义存储过程和触发器,这些特性使得数据库能够执行复杂的业务逻辑,自动响应数据变化,为数据分析提供了更多灵活性和自动化手段
结语 综上所述,MySQL以其全面的数据管理功能、卓越的性能优化能力、严密的安全防护措施以及强大的数据分析能力,成为了duocijo以及无数数据专业人士信赖的伙伴
在这个数据爆炸的时代,MySQL不仅帮助企业构建了坚实的数据基础,更为数据驱动的决策提供了无限可能
无论是初创企业还是大型机构,MySQL都能以其灵活性和可扩展性,满足多样化的数据管理和分析需求,助力企业在数据海洋中稳健航行,探索未知的商业宝藏
未来,随着技术的不断进步,MySQL将继续演进,为数据时代带来更多惊喜和可能
MySQL编码格式设置全攻略
MySQL技巧揭秘:掌握duocijo应用
MySQL表关系导入实战指南
DB2数据迁移至MySQL全攻略
MySQL数据库:轻松设置独特口号的实用指南
MySQL缓存机制:一级二级缓存实战解析
MySQL复合索引高效应用条件解析
MySQL编码格式设置全攻略
MySQL表关系导入实战指南
DB2数据迁移至MySQL全攻略
MySQL数据库:轻松设置独特口号的实用指南
MySQL缓存机制:一级二级缓存实战解析
MySQL复合索引高效应用条件解析
MySQL字符数字混合数据排序技巧
MySQL视图映射:数据洞察新视角
MySQL修改约束:语法详解与操作指南
MySQL教程:如何授权用户具备权限管理功能
如何正确进行MySQL的正常卸载
MySQL字段依赖关系解析